Pipe Bender Worker

Specialized profession that processes metal pipes into angles and curves as specified in blueprints using dedicated bending machines.

Scissors Manufacturing Worker

A metal processing technician specialized in manufacturing scissors. Handles everything from material selection to forging, heat treatment, blading, polishing, assembly, adjustment, and inspection in an integrated manner.

Spring Coiling Worker

A manufacturing technical job that handles metal springs from forging, forming, heat treatment, to finishing processes.

Spring Manufacturer (Cold Forming Method)

A job that forms and processes metal wire into spring shapes using cold press processing to manufacture coil springs, leaf springs, etc.

Bandsaw Manufacturing Worker

This occupation involves handling everything from parts processing to assembly, adjustment, and inspection in the manufacturing process of band saws (bandsaws).

Planer Milling Machine Operator

Skilled worker who uses a general-purpose machine tool called a planer milling machine to perform cutting machining on metal parts and finish dimensions and shapes.

Flash (Spark) Welder

Flash welders are specialists who use electrical resistance to heat and melt the joining surfaces of metal members and join them by applying pressure.

Brushing Worker (Steel Pipe Manufacturing)

Brushing workers remove unnecessary substances such as scale and burrs from steel pipes using brush machines or manual brushes in the steel pipe manufacturing process, and smooth the surface. They contribute to maintaining product quality and improving processing efficiency in subsequent processes.
